List by list
Republic of Ireland · Boys62 shared years, 1964–2025
Colm held the stronger position in 28 of those years, Luke in 34.
Highest recorded here: Colm #32 in 1970, Luke #7 in 2006.
The order changed in 1992: Luke moved ahead. In 1991 they stood at #47 and #51; by 1992 that had become #47 and #41.
Most recent shared year, 2025: Colm #286, Luke #23.
England and Wales · Boys25 shared years, 1996–2024
Colm held the stronger position in 0 of those years, Luke in 25.
Highest recorded here: Colm #567 in 1997, Luke #11 in 1997.
The order between them never changed and held in this list.
Most recent shared year, 2024: Colm #5119, Luke #138.
Northern Ireland · Boys23 shared years, 1997–2021
Colm held the stronger position in 0 of those years, Luke in 23.
Highest recorded here: Colm #96 in 1997, Luke #13 in 2005.
The order between them never changed and held in this list.
Most recent shared year, 2021: Colm #433, Luke #36.
